发明名称 PLANT AND SYSTEM FOR THE AUTOMATIC HORIZONTAL ASSEMBLY OF PHOTOVOLTAIC PANELS WITH FRONT-BACK CONNECTION OF THE CELLS AND PRE-FIXING
摘要 A plant and system for the automatic horizontal assembly of photovoltaic panels with front-back-contact solar cells of crystalline silicon, of the type called H-type, the contacting being carried out at a temperature lower than 150° C. also with the pre-fixing of conductive elements onto the encapsulating layer. The plant and system solve the main problems of the conventional stringing systems and provides high production capacity with a precise positioning of the components. The plant is made up of single workstations of the modular type which are arranged sequentially in a linear series, individually equipped according to the specific working process, being adjacent and laterally open to be crossed by the conveying line of the trays containing the panels being worked. After the automatic assembly in the plant, the panels are ready to be rolled in conventional furnaces.

主权项 1. Plant (10) for the automatic assembly of photovoltaic panels (30) with solar cells of the H-type, with front-back connection of the cells carried out at low temperature, comprising workstations which progressively assemble the panel (30) within a tray (109), requiring the previous loading of a supporting backsheet (309) with a layer of encapsulating material (310), said stations being of the type crossed by a continuous conveying line (110) with recirculation of trays (109), said plant (10) being characterised in that said workstations (100) are modular elements shaped as right-angled parallelepipeds sequentially arranged in a linear series (100A-I); said stations (100A-I), being adjacent in correspondence of at least one side opening (107) of each station (100A-I) in such a way as to be horizontally crossed by said conveying line (110) of the trays (109) both at the level of the working surface (111) and at the level of the recirculation (112), which is parallel and underlying with respect to it; said workstations (100A-I) comprising automatic conveying and working means of the type with Cartesian robot (101), with a structure (102) with mobile gantry (102b) for roto-translation (118a-d) on power-operated rails (102a) and at least one mobile head (103,119a-b); and wherein each mobile gantry (102b) is constrained to said power-operated rails (102a) in such a way as to enable the horizontal translation and also the rotation (118d) around the vertical axis, facilitating the automatic alignments; said mobile head (103), being power-operated at least to translate horizontally (119a) along the longitudinal axis of the mobile gantry (102b) and also to operate vertically (119b); said mobile head (103) comprising means for the pneumatic loading and/or means for the measured and calibrated dispensing of material intended for electrical contacting and/or means for pre-fixing by localised heating, in such a way as to enable the horizontal assembly of all the components by progressive superimpositions on said backsheet (309, 310) loaded on the tray (109) with the encapsulating material (310) facing upwards, to form a panel (30) ready for rolling; said plant (10) comprising from upstream to downstream the following workstations (100): a first station (100A) of loading on the tray of said backsheet (309) with the encapsulating material (310), a second station (100B) of application of the cross ribbons (303-4), with ECA and pre-fixing, a third station (100C) of application of the first row of interconnecting ribbons (302), with ECA and pre-fixing, a fourth station (100D) of laying in rows of the cells (300-1) and of the related interconnecting ribbons (302), in alternated and repeated series, with ECA and pre-fixing, an optional fifth station (100E) twin of the previous station in such a way as to complete the cover in a rapid and complementary way, a sixth station (100F) of laying of the front encapsulating material, a seventh station (100G) of laying of the front glass, an eighth station (100H) of overturn and outcoming of the compliant panel (30), a ninth station (100I) of recirculation of the tray (109) made empty, if the panel (30) is compliant, or of deviation, if the panel (30) is non-compliant; at least said stations (100A-G) comprising automatic control devices for checking the single working processes performed and for the calibration of the movements, being of the type with cameras and vision software electronically integrated with the logic control unit (117) of the plant (10); said plant (10) being managed by a programmable logic control unit (117), which supervises the whole plant in an integrated way.
